EXPERT PICKS BY KAITLIN FREE

SATURDAY, SEPTEMBER 9

RACE 1
(2) AFRAID NOT – Nearly won last out here over the hurdles going over a mile further. Has form on the flat too at the distance & will hang on just fine. Should appreciate the weight break getting Toledo aboard
(1) KRONE – Ran very well here last out over the surface just shorter than this with a troubled run. Also has a just miss 2nd this year at the same distance at Pimlico. Knocking on the door & could be a winner with a cleaner trip
(6) POR UNA CABEZA – Will take a lot of money & rightfully so, first out today for the Graham Motion barn. Good barn coming off the layoff but hasn’t been seen in 7 months – not a short distance either coming from off the shelf, might need one

RACE 2
(2) CONNECTAMUNDO – Liked what I saw from this colt on debut, got out of the gates slow but churned away late & made up ground. Should improve at 2nd asking against a similar group, big rider pick up in Julien Leparoux
(1) DIALED IN A PANIC – Huge meet so far for the Aguirre barn at 38%, not a ton of runners but what has been running is doing very well. Decent numbers in the maiden claim levels, just doesn’t start a lot of juveniles
(6) IMPERIALITY – Drops in class off of a key last out race, that race winner is potentially one of the top 2YO’s in the country. Only concern is that jockey Gavin Ashton opts to a first time starter instead

RACE 3
(6) YANKEE DOLLAR – Tough to swallow at that 3-2 ML, but not a ton of pace signed on to oppose this filly. Impressive win here two back over this surface at the distance, if she runs that race back she should notch another win
(8) DIVINE EXCHANGE – Don’t overlook coming in from Gulfstream on the tapeta. Fausto Gutierrez barn has been huge this meet, 44% & nothing has ran off the board. Should appreciate being back on the grass
(4) PANOTTI – Struggled here two back against Yankee Dollar, but certainly more interesting today with Jose Ortiz back in the irons. Will have to work out a trip coming from off the pace most likely

RACE 4
(3) LAKESIDE GETAWAY – Was wide going one turn last out at Saratoga, love the stretch out to the two turns today. 31% between the Trombetta barn & Paco Lopez within the year
(1) WAY TOO EARLY – Comes out of both longer & shorter races, this distance here could hit him between the eyes. Huge 50% this meet for the Shug McGaughey barn, 29% going from a MSW to a maiden claim level
(6) TRIBEST (ARG) – Makes sense getting back on the grass after not handling a couple runs on the dirt. Working sharply at Churchill Downs for the Kenny McPeek barn coming in

RACE 5
(4) SEVEN BRIDGES ROAD – Back on a week’s rest to run one last time this meet, just as good on the grass as he is the dirt & is in career best form. Probably also this horse’s top distance
(8) BRYCE CANYON – Very similar to the 4 & should also get a good pace set up. Very good on the grass but possibly better on the all weather. 0 for 5 at the distance
(2) FINGAL – Has a bit to find to be able to win the race, but is a must use underneath with the prowess for the track. Distance a bit short for him but the consistency this meet has been too good to ignore

RACE 6
(9) OUTLAW KID – Will get the perfect set up if both the 7 & 8 go forward, has an excellent turn of foot & can work out a trip anywhere from 5 to 6 ½ furlongs. Jose Ortiz 29% within the year teaming up with the George Weaver barn
(8) NOBALS – In my opinion the best horse in the race but could be significantly be compromised with the 7 having a very similar running style. Can come from off the pace but it has been awhile, wouldn’t put it past him a bit to win though
(6) YES AND YES – Ran very well two back here to just miss behind Front Run the Fed in the Van Clief Stakes. 2nd in this race last year & loves this surface. Should be in the mix again

RACE 7
(7) MANABI – Impressive on debut here at this distance, don’t see a ton of pace to go forward with him either. 27% for the Delacour barn coming in off of a win, calls upon main man Victor Carrasco to retain the mount
(8) SKELLIG ISLAND – Gets the acid test in here on a big step up in class, but the debut was sharp & made an impressive move for a first time starter. 40% from a sizeable sample size with Karamanos in the saddle for the barn
(3) TRIPLE ESPRESSO – Can’t discount anything from the Todd Pletcher barn, but big ask debuting today in a stakes race going the two turns. Will take a ton of money in here & if you like someone else you should get the price

RACE 8
(5) NO NAY METS (IRE) – Didn’t have the cleanest run at Royal Ascot but has been perfect elsewhere. Last race out at Monmouth has produced several winners since that were a good ways behind him. Don’t see a lot in here that could hang with him
(3) TOUPIE – Moves from the dirt to the grass today, debut at Laurel was very impressive & came back pretty fast. 25% between Jorge Ruiz & the Graham Motion barn on the year, should handle the surface switch just fine
(11) AIR RECRUIT – Maiden win here on debut was strong, the other two that made up the trifecta have also broken their maiden since. Has the key experience over the surface & likes it very much

RACE 9
(7) MISSION OF JOY – A bit disappointing last out in the G1 Belmont Oaks as the favorite but is back to her best distance today & reunites with previous regular rider Antonio Gallardo. Lots to like in a race where she looks the best on paper
(6) THIRTY THOU KELVIN – Could be the forgotten horse in this race with bigger entries coming in from New York, but this filly is proven at the distance herself. Career best last out at Delaware winning on the lead going 1 ⅛
(8) ALPHA BELLA – Renews her rivalry with Mission of Joy here today, I just prefer Mission of Joy a bit more & still think this filly has a bit to find on her. Back on the turf after crushing a field on the dirt by 23 lengths last out at Saratoga

RACE 10
(11) PROGRAM TRADING (GB) – Unbeaten in three starts & hard to deny in this spot. Has to handle the ground but is extremely versatile so it shouldn’t be a problem. Regular rider Flavien Prat follows him into town
(9) INTEGRATION – Unconventional move here for the McGaughey barn putting this horse in stakes company off of the debut, but the debut here was huge. Likes the surface & looks like he’ll stretch out just fine. Don’t miss at a price
(2) GIGANTE – Loves this track & keeps improving with every start. Stretch out in distance looks very optimal, & should get some pace to run at. Sharp last out work to prepare for this, will be sharp again

RACE 11
(11) GLIDER – Really nice last out win over a surface he loves here, steps back up in trip & it seems the longer the better for him. Improving with every start for a hot barn in Mark Casse
(4) MCLOVIN – Ran very well last out at Ellis Park at a similar distance at a price. Winner of that race has gone on to be G1 quality. Also reunites with previous rider Julien Leparoux
(6) TEMPLE – Has the most experience at this distance & some of the highest numbers & figures. Does have to shake off some rust coming in off of a 9 month layoff. Regular rider Jose Ortiz back aboard
